Voluntary Food Recall - 60 Count Parsley
September 11, 2009: Muranaka Farm, Inc. was notified today that parsley purchased from our company had tested positive for Salmonella Type H.
As a result, the company is immediately implementing a voluntary recall of the 1,005 cases of the 60 count fresh bunched parsley Lot Code 0023909.
"The health of all consumers is of the utmost importance to every employee of our company. With that in mind, even though this product is now past the useable shelf life and no illnesses have been reported, we have taken immediate actions to ensure that all product is accounted for and out of the supply chain. We are working with all of our customers to insure this product is no longer being distributed." said Greg Emi, President, Muranaka Farm, Inc.
Because of Muranaka Farm's trace recall program the company was able to immediately determine which customers purchased the product in question. Muranaka's food safety protocols also ensure the company was able to determine the amount of cases harvested, the crew harvesting the product, and the field on which the parsley was grown and harvested.
Muranaka Farm is asking all customers to confirm the disposition of the product and to destroy any remaining product with the lot code 0023909.
